Drupal 8: Custom theme site logo

The simple way to custom your site logo in Drupal8 is to upload your logo with the name logo.svg in your custom theme directory. The Path is something like : sites/YOUR-SITE.com/themes/MY-THEME/logo.svg. This will override the Drupal8 default logo.

The second way is from the Backend . Just go to Appearance->Settings->Global settings and in the “Logo image settings” give the path where your logo.png  is.

Just change “YOUR-SITE.com”  and  “MY-THEME”  with your custom folder names.
